What are the most popular songs for Contemporary Hip Hop musician R-Ash?
With a variety of captivating songs, R-Ash, a modern Hip Hop rapper from Paris, France, has grown in popularity. His most popular songs include "A part ca... tout va bien," with Rash, Besti, Ascension, Sboko, Vichy Las Vegas, and Jamadom, and "Tant que la foule braille (Rien a foutre)," with Beks, Kazkami, T. Killa, Rash, and Blaspheme. These songs demonstrate R-Ash's capacity for working with different musicians to produce tunes that connect with listeners.
The remix of "Ma Benz," which includes Lord Kossity, is another noteworthy song. R-Ash's ability to reimagine music is demonstrated by this remix, which gives the original song a novel and contemporary touch. Another remix by R-Ash, "Back dans les bacs," exemplifies his versatility as a musician and his capacity to ingratiate his own style into pre-existing tunes.
Along with these songs, R-Ash also released "Wesh les taulards," which he co-wrote with DJ R-Ash, "Snow," "I Own You" (Yung Wall Street Remix), "I Own You" (Vices Remix), and "#Idly." Which are the most important collaborations with other musicians for Contemporary Hip Hop musician R-Ash?
The French modern hip-hop artist R-Ash has worked with a variety of musicians during the course of his career. He paired up with Supreme NTM and Lord Kossity on the song "Ma Benz (feat. Lord Kossity) - R-Ash Remix," which is one of their memorable collaborations. This remix gives the original song a new perspective while highlighting R-Ash's own musicality and flair.
"Back dans les bacs - R-Ash Remix," another impressive joint effort with Supreme NTM. With this remix, R-Ash puts his creative spin to the classic song, giving it a fresh spin while maintaining the spirit of the original.
